Sidharth Rao to exit Dentsu at the end of the year
Sidharth Rao, CEO, dentsuMB Group India, will be leaving the agency in December 2022. Rao plans to turn entrepreneur again. He had founded Webchutney in 1999, which was acquired by dentsu in 2013.
 
Post this, dentsuMB India will come under the additional charge of Heeru Dingra, CEO, Isobar India group.
 
Dingra will be supported by business leaders Ajit Devraj, Indrajeet Mookerjee and Harsh Shah. The new dentsuMB India leadership team will work with Rao through the transition along with Amit Wadhwa, CEO, dentsu Creative India.
